
ABOUT WACRA
Western Australian Cardiovascular Research Alliance
Mission Statement
We are the peak leadership body in Western Australia advancing research into heart, stroke and vascular disease to accelerate translation and improve health outcomes for all Western Australians.
We represent all cardiovascular researchers working across the pipeline from fundamental pre-clinical research, epidemiology and public health through to clinical trials.

WACRA Affiliates
Established in 2019 the Western Australian Cardiovascular Research Alliance unites cardiovascular researchers from universities, institutes and affiliated hospitals in Western Australia.
​
These include:
​
-
The University of Western Australia (UWA)
-
Edith Cowan University (ECU)
-
Curtin University
-
Notre Dame University
-
Murdoch University
-
Western Australian Health Translation Network (WAHTN)
-
RPH Medical Research Foundation
-
Perron Institute
-
Harry Perkins Institute of Medical Research
